A dramatic tale of ambition, crime, and a brilliant doctor who tests the limits of science and sanity.
In this novel, two young lawyers chase a sensational murder case that grips New York's legal world. As they dive into a mysterious death on a boardinghouse, a captivating physician enters the scene with a mind as sharp as his intellect. The story blends courtroom intrigue with philosophical debates about immortality, the soul, and what science should dare to do.

Paperback. Zustand: New. Print on Demand. This book tells a tale of an eccentric physician named Dr. Emanuel Medjora. Suspected of murder, Medjora retains the services of two young lawyers who set out eagerly to aid the accused man. As they investigate Medjora's case, they delve into a shadowy world of secret knowledge, ancient mysteries, and hidden depths within the human psyche. The book explores questions of morality and justice, and challenges conventional notions of truth and reality.
